Purpose of the Position:

The Academic Advisor I/II will serve as a resource for College of Science students, faculty, staff and community.

Duties/Responsibilities
● Meeting with students in person or virtually, 8 or more meetings per day and being available for “Walk-in” advising appointments.
● Actively listening and providing individual service and assistance during advising appointments and through email exchanges.
● Becoming or displaying proficiency in accessing and using UAH student centered software including my.uah.edu, UAH Course catalog, Degree Works, Banner, and Google Suite.
● Becoming knowledgeable about majors and minors in the College of Science, and guide students in accordance with their interests using UAH student centered software.
● Becoming conversant with UAH courses, including Charger Foundations, and applies transfer credits, AP/IB credits, and placement exams to a student’s advantage.
● Assisting students with course registration using Schedule Planner software and other relevant registration methods.
● Monitoring student progress through creating, maintaining, and updating a personalized long-range plan for each student.
● Analyzing each student’s long-range plan at least twice a year (January/May/September). Includes reviewing each student’s transcript, Degree Works profile, and tracking their overall degree progress.
● Updating student information using Native Banner software to reflect accurate degree information.
● Displaying sensitivity in addressing the unique and sometimes complex learning and socioeconomic needs of students.
● Gaining familiarity with and directing students to UAH resources such as Career Services, Student Health Center, and the Student Success Center.
● Reviewing reports including failed pre-requisites, Course Program of Study (CPOS), and non-registered students three times a year.
● Reviewing the override request form and entering overrides as needed.
● Communicating with students who appear on reports and assists them so they can be successful and continue to pursue their degrees.
● Adjusting a student’s Degree Works profile as needed to assist students with their Financial Aid concerns.
● Identifying students who may benefit from academic assistance to reach good standing (i.e., a 6th course repeat, a late withdrawal, etc.).
● Meeting with prospective students in person or virtually, and being available to for “Walk-in” advising appointments.
● Advising students during COS orientation sessions.
● Participating in outreach activities which may include Discovery Days, Charger Preview events, and Week of Welcome.
● Assisting in First year experience (FYE)/Charger Success presentations related to Degree Works and GPA.
● Becoming an active member of the National Academic Advising Association (NACADA) and attending 1 conference a year as possible for professional development.
